M465 RFS is a 1994 Volkswagen Polo in Blue with a 1,043c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.8%.
Across all 1994 Volkswagen Polo models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.5% with a typical mileage of 75,994 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volkswagen Polo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 467,706 recorded failures. If you're considering buying M465 RFS,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volkswagen Polo typ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 32 years old, this Volkswagen Polo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
